Luanne Platter in "King of the Hill" was a significant character who was Peggy Hill's niece and was taken in by the Hill family. Over the original series, she evolved from a somewhat clueless teenager into a mom and wife, marrying Lucky Kleinschmidt and having a daughter named Gracie. However, in the "King of the Hill" revival (season 14) streaming on Hulu, Luanne does not appear at all, nor is she mentioned. This absence is due to the death of Brittany Murphy, the actress who voiced Luanne, in 2009. The show's creators chose not to recast her character out of respect for Murphy's memory. The revival also excludes her husband Lucky and does not provide any update or closure about their characters or their daughter Gracie. The creators decided to "retire" these characters, essentially preserving the memories and legacy associated with them without continuing their storylines in the new season. The absence leaves the fate of Luanne and Lucky open-ended, with an implication that they might have moved away from Arlen, but no concrete explanation is given in the show. This decision was made to honor the original actors and avoid replacing beloved voices, even though it leaves some fans without closure on what happened to these characters after the original series ended.
